hey all, hope some of you guys are getting some good weather, currently im trying to figure out why my bike is running rough, i think ive narrowed it down to needing new spark plug caps, but im also not sure if i have the ht leads going to the correct cylinders, i cant find any mention in the haynes book or this forum for what order the engine fires in AND which coil pack does which cylinder, any help would be much appreciated, many thanks in advance!!
-
1 and 4 are fed from the left coil and 2 and 3 from the right coil, looking at them as if you are sitting on the bike.Cylinders are 1, 2, 3, 4 again left to right for the position mentioned

And the firing order is 1-3-4-2
-
BB going on the valve clearances check it has to be 1-2-4-3
Check Cyl 1 with all valve closed
rotate 180degrees cyl 2 all valves closed
rotate 180 degrees cyl 4 all valves closed
and finally rotate 180 and 3 all valves
